My quit date is set for the 9th of April. Its my birthday and I've already made plans to go to Vegas. Not sure if I should change my quit date until after. It will be difficult to not smoke in the casino and I plan on having a few drinks. Should I rise to the challenge and keep my quit date? I could not drink alcohol, that won't be a problem. Not sure what to do. Help. My husband also smokes and he's agreed not to smoke at home or around me when I quit, but he will smoke when we go to Vegas. Any suggestions?

Hi, I know the "right" thing is to say keep to your quit date but to be honest withyou if youre anything like me with your smokes quitting is going to be hard enough. If I was planning on going to Vegas I think I would try to quit after I got back. Will seem extra hard while youre having fun & husband is smoking, you know? Do what you think you can do I just would be setting myslef up for disappointment. There is nothing unusual going on for me April 1st just going to be home but I still think its going to be really hard. My husband has agreed to smoke outside too. I wish I could get him to do it with me would be more support.

I quit on my way home from Vegas on March 11th at 10:30 am (right when I got off of the airport shuttle). I am on day 12 and it is getting better...still tough, but easier than yesterday, and the day before.

I could not have done it before we went to Vegas, no way! After being there with all of the late night acitivities, drinks, and smoking more than than you normally do, it was almost refreshing & rejuvinating to toss my pack in the garbage at the airport.

You can do it! If I can go for 12 days thus far after smoking for almost 30 years, you can do it!
